On Mon, Mar 15, 1999 at 11:38:07PM -0500, Adam Di Carlo wrote:
> There is no xserver-configure for the xserver-xsun line AFAIK.  There
> is no configuration required on the systems supported by those
> servers.
> 
> The default X servers for other sparc machines (such as my matrox64)
> assume that /dev/mouse is valid.  I don't see why it shouldn't be.
> It is valid for x86, right?

Not without user action (AFAICT). The system doesn't adjust the symlink
automatically (say I have a PS/2 mouse in /dev/psaux, or a serial one in 
/dev/ttyS1, or...). (I think new XF86Setup adjusts it on the mouse
selection step). As X defaults to /dev/mouse, and you say there's no
configuration required for xserver-xsun, I'd say that package should
create the /dev/mouse -> /dev/sunmouse symlink.

I still fail to see why that's a boot-floppies issue. 
Perhaps we should ship that symlink on sparc's base system?
